A gift given, A gift taken: collection of poems ~ Plus takes on different categories and topics in poetic forms, addressing sisterhood, relationships, love, nature, and of God the Creator. There are also two stories to further engaged the readers’ interest. This book is an introduction to my dreams, my world of imaginations, and the Spirit realness of the Savior, that is in the mix of all aspects of this book and my being.
“A Gift Given, A Gift Taken: Collection of poems-plus” the book presents a diverse blend of poems and short stories that delve into various themes such as love, nature, desires, and spirituality. Juliet Barriffe’s reflections are deeply rooted in an acknowledgment of the Creator’s presence, infusing each piece with a sense of the divine.
Through the exploration of love, beauty, peace, and hope, the book invites readers into a world where imagination breathes life into the stories that shape our lives. There’s a yearning for a world devoid of struggles, where every individual, regardless of their perceived significance, finds a place of honor.
Amidst the imperfections of the world, her advocates for acceptance, understanding, and empathy towards others’ weaknesses and struggles. Within these verses and stories lies a beacon of hope for those grappling with melancholy or fear, offering a chance to rediscover joy, dreams, and love, or to find solace in a connection with a higher power.
Her introspective nature as an introvert is beautifully portrayed through vivid imagination, capturing both the visible and invisible realms intertwined with heartfelt emotions. The inclusion of short stories adds a fictional dimension that introduces readers to her storytelling prowess. Overall, “A Gift Given, A Gift Taken” serves as a window into her dreams and imaginative world, while also weaving in the profound spiritual essence that threads through every aspect of the book and her essence.
– Logan Crawford (Spotlight Network TV host)
